Asthma is a disease of diffuse airway inflammation caused by a variety of triggering stimuli resulting in partially or completely reversible bronchoconstriction. Symptoms and signs include dyspnea, chest tightness, cough, and wheezing. The diagnosis is based on history, physical examination, and pulmonary function tests.

WebMay 15, 2000 · Symptoms and airway hyperreactivity can persist for years after the incriminating exposure. RADS differs from occupational asthma in that it typically occurs after a single exposure without a preceding period of sensitization.
